2001 Joseph Phelps Insignia

Community Tasting Note

Likes this wine:

95 Points

Friday, July 16, 2021 - Opaque purple. Essence of cassis with saddle leather, fresh pipe tobacco, mesquite charcoal and Asian spice. Full through the mid-palate with rich, sweet dark berries and an interesting mineral tone. My only qualm was this was a bit drying on the back-end. Still, a fantastic bottle.
